Existence in the City of Hurghada, Egypt: A Thorough Overview

Hurghada, this vibrant beachfront city in Egypt, offers the truly distinctive lifestyle environment for inhabitants. The pace of life is generally relaxed, particularly when compared to more bustling cities like Cairo, allowing ample time to enjoy this beautiful environment. You'll find an combination of native culture and expat influences, producing an diverse community. While modern amenities and upscale resorts are readily available, traditional Egyptian charm is remains evident throughout the city. Housing choices span from modest apartments to spacious villas, often with magnificent views of the Red Sea. Remember that this climate is hot, particularly during the hotter months, but the pleasant winters draw numerous visitors and prospective people.

Experiencing Hurghada as an Foreigner

Venturing into a expat scene in Hurghada presents a rewarding blend of opportunities and potential hurdles. Locating suitable accommodation can be a initial challenge, often requiring investigation and local guidance. Recurring concerns revolve around medical care accessibility, bureaucratic paperwork, and dealing with cultural nuances. However, the growing expat community acts as a valuable resource, offering practical advice, social connections, and shared sense of camaraderie. Many find immense satisfaction in the relaxed pace of life, budget-friendly cost of sustenance, and ease to spectacular Red Sea. Becoming part of local communities – whether centered around hobbies, business, or simply social gatherings – is strongly suggested to fully integrate into Hurghada's expat experience.

Transitioning to Hurghada: The Essentials You Need to Know

Considering a relocation to Hurghada, the Red Sea resort? It’s a wonderful prospect for many, drawn by the beautiful weather, stunning beaches, and reasonable living. However, prior to your departure, it's vital to research a few key aspects. Housing can range from luxurious resorts to basic apartments, so anticipate a wide variety of rates. Getting around local processes, such as residency requirements and setting up utilities, can be difficult without some prior planning. Furthermore, acquiring a few basic phrases of Arabic will greatly improve your time and create better connections with the local community. Finally, expect a different cultural environment and embrace the possibilities it presents.

Uncovering Hurghada: The Desert Gem

Hurghada truly offers something for all traveler. Aside from the stunning azure waters, this Egyptian city boasts a remarkable blend of leisure and adventure. Picture spending your mornings basking on pristine sandy beaches like Mahmya or Paradise Beach, perfect for relaxing. Exploring enthusiasts will be thrilled by the vibrant coral reefs and colorful marine life that thrive beneath the surface – sites like Abu Ramada Island and the El Mina wreck provide world-class underwater experiences. But don't just stick to the shoreline; delve into the authentic culture with a visit to the dahar, where you can explore through bustling markets, sample delicious Egyptian dishes, and experience the genuine friendliness of the regional people. In short, Hurghada provides a memorable getaway filled with wonder.
